I received an email this morning from LifePoints stating that my earnings are approaching the US IRS amount of $600 and in order to continue receiving rewards I had to fill out a form. Instructions were given on how to do this and then I was told I'd receive a 1099 form in the mail.

My earnings with them are FAR from approaching $600. Matter of fact I haven't even  earned half of that.  ( I have a detailed list of what I've earned)

I just cashed out for a $25 gc and it seems to me that they are saying I won't get the gc unless I fill out all my tax information which I do NOT want to do. There is no need to give them all that personal information as I'll never earn over $300 in the next 2 weeks!

Has anyone else gotten such a letter? Did you fill out their forms? 

Many thanks for your help here!
